What Diagnostic Microbiology and Infectious Disease specifies

The figures below follow your selected manuscript type. Review proposed changes and verify the final manuscript against the official author guidance.

  • Case Report 11 rules, including: word limit (1250 words), abstract word limit (250 words), figure limit (1 figures), table limit (1 tables), display item limit (1 items).

Read from Diagnostic Microbiology and Infectious Disease's own author guidelines. Journals revise these - verify with the journal before you submit.
